Our mission is to safeguard the public interest in sound standards of higher educ qualifications and to inform and encourage continuous improvement in the management of thequality of higher educ. We do this by working with higher educinstitutions to define academic standards and quality, and we carry out and publish reviews against these standards. We were established in 1997 and are an independent body funded by subscriptions from UK universities and colleges of higher educ, and through contracts with the main UK higher educ funding bodies.

Founded in 1903, the WEA (Workers' Educational Association) is a charity and the UK's largest voluntary sector provider of adult educ, delivering 9,500 part-time courses for over 74,000 people each year in England and Scotland, from all walks of life, maintaining their special mission to provide educ opportunities to adults facing social and economic disadvantage. Courses are created and provided through the regional offices and volunteer-led branches, often in partnership with local community groups and orgs.
